    Intraoperative blood pressure and cerebral perfusion: strategies to clarify hemodynamic goals.

    • Monica Williams and Jennifer K Lee.
    • Department of Anesthesiology and Critical Care Medicine, Johns Hopkins University, Baltimore, MD, USA.
    • Paediatr Anaesth. 2014 Jul 1;24(7):657-67.

    AbstractBlood pressure can vary considerably during anesthesia. If blood pressure falls outside the limits of cerebrovascular autoregulation, children can become at risk of cerebral ischemic or hyperemic injury. However, the blood pressure limits of autoregulation are unclear in infants and children, and these limits can shift after brain injury. This article will review autoregulation, considerations for the hemodynamic management of children with brain injuries, and research on autoregulation monitoring techniques.© 2014 John Wiley & Sons Ltd.
